人体感应灯作为智能家居的一部分,给我们的生活带来了极大的便利。然而,有时我们可能会遇到人体感应灯常亮不启动的问题。本文将为您揭秘这一问题,并提供实用的维修指南。
一、问题分析
人体感应灯常亮不启动的原因可能有很多,以下是一些常见的原因:
- 感应范围问题:人体感应灯的感应范围过小,可能无法正确感应到人体。
- 感应角度问题:人体感应灯的感应角度不正确,导致无法正确检测到人体。
- 感应灵敏度问题:人体感应灯的灵敏度设置过高或过低,导致无法正常工作。
- 电路故障:人体感应灯的电路存在短路或断路等问题。
- 外部干扰:其他电子设备对人体感应灯造成了干扰。
二、维修指南
针对以上问题,以下是相应的维修方法:
1. 检查感应范围
首先,检查人体感应灯的感应范围是否合适。如果感应范围过小,可以尝试调整灯的位置或感应角度。
代码示例(针对编程相关维修):
// 假设有一个函数用于设置感应范围
public void setInfraredRange(int range) {
// 调整人体感应灯的感应范围
}
2. 调整感应角度
检查人体感应灯的感应角度是否正确。如果感应角度不正确,可以尝试调整灯的位置或感应角度。
代码示例(针对编程相关维修):
// 假设有一个函数用于设置感应角度
public void setInfraredAngle(int angle) {
// 调整人体感应灯的感应角度
}
3. 调整感应灵敏度
检查人体感应灯的灵敏度设置。如果灵敏度设置过高或过低,可以尝试调整灵敏度。
代码示例(针对编程相关维修):
// 假设有一个函数用于设置感应灵敏度
public void setInfraredSensitivity(int sensitivity) {
// 调整人体感应灯的感应灵敏度
}
4. 检查电路
检查人体感应灯的电路是否存在短路或断路等问题。如果电路存在故障,需要请专业人员维修。
代码示例(针对编程相关维修):
// 假设有一个函数用于检测电路
public boolean checkCircuit() {
// 检测人体感应灯的电路
return true; // 返回检测结果
}
5. 检查外部干扰
检查人体感应灯附近是否存在其他电子设备,如微波炉、蓝牙设备等。如果存在干扰,尝试将干扰源远离人体感应灯。
三、总结
人体感应灯常亮不启动的原因有多种,通过以上维修指南,您可以根据实际情况进行排查和维修。在维修过程中,请确保安全,必要时请寻求专业人士的帮助。希望本文对您有所帮助!
